You cannot directly import a song from Spotify to GarageBand because Spotify's music is protected by DRM (Digital Rights Management). Instead, you can use royalty-free music or create your own tracks within GarageBand to achieve your desired results.
FAQs & Answers
- Why can't I import Spotify songs into GarageBand? Spotify songs are protected by DRM (Digital Rights Management), which prevents direct importing into GarageBand or other editing software.
- What are the alternatives to using Spotify music in GarageBand? You can use royalty-free music, create your own tracks within GarageBand, or purchase DRM-free music for your projects.
- How do I create music within GarageBand? GarageBand offers a variety of virtual instruments, loops, and recording features that allow you to compose and produce your own music from scratch.
